Kieran Culkin’s SAG Awards: Heavy on Humor and Acknowledgments

Kieran Culkin stole the spotlight during his acceptance speech at the SAG Awards, and not for the reasons you might expect. After winning the award for Male Actor in a Supporting Role for his performance in the gripping drama about generational trauma in Poland, the actor found himself completely distracted by the weight of the trophy. Honestly, it was the kind of moment that could only happen at an awards show, right?
As he hoisted the hefty statue, Culkin’s thoughts seemed released from the confines of the usual “Thank you” protocols; instead, he started a light-hearted monologue about how actors have truly outdone themselves by designing such a weighty piece of hardware. “This must be what it’s for!” he quipped, as he hilariously struggled to balance the trophy on the table. It’s clear that while most winners might rattle off gratitude to directors, family, and friends, Kieran was at least temporarily obsessed with the sheer mass of his prize.
He did eventually manage to throw in some quick thank-yous, including a shoutout to his friend and the director of “A Real Pain,” Jesse Eisenberg. Time was of the essence though—he ticked off the names in a speedy 30 seconds before making his exit, leaving us all wondering if he had covered everyone. Culkin is no stranger to accolades; this SAG win adds to a growing collection that includes a BAFTA, Golden Globe, and Critics Choice Award, with the Academy Awards looming just around the corner.
